Group Health to Provide Free Physicals Aug. 13 at Everett High School
Student athletes can kick off the school year with a healthy start by getting a free physical from Group Health medical staff Aug. 13.

Student athletes can kick off the school year with a healthy start by getting a free physical from Group Health medical staff members on Saturday, Aug. 13 at Everett High School.
Who: Families with student athletes in Snohomish County and surrounding communities.
What: As a service to the community, Group Health medical staff members will be conducting free physicals on Saturday, Aug. 13 from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. at Everett High School.

When: Saturday, Aug. 13 from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m.
Where: Everett High School Gym, 2416 Colby Avenue, Everett, Wash. 98201

Details: Any middle or high school student who is participating in fall sports is eligible. A completed sports physical form from the student’s school is required.
